I removed all packages from xpra and installed the following specific versions of the following packages:
yum remove xorg-x11-drv-dummy-0.3.8-1.xpra1.el6_10.x86_64 xpra-common-1.0.12-2.r19800.el6_9.noarch python2-rencode-1.0.6-1.xpra1.el6_10.x86_64 x264-xpra-20170704-1.el6_8.x86_64 python2-pyopengl-3.1.1a1-10xpra1.el6_10.x86_64 libvpx-xpra-1.7.0-1.el6_10.x86_64
yum --setopt=obsoletes=0 install -y x264-xpra-20170704-1.el6_8.x86_64 ; yum --setopt=obsoletes=0 install -y xpra-1.0.12-1.r19858.el6_10.x86_64
This works for xpra-1.0.12.
When trying to update to version xpra-1.0.13, dependency chain is broken like kleber said. Update asks for libx264.so.148, which is not available, because the update installs x264-xpra-20190109-1.el6_8.x86_64, who has libx264.so.155.
x264-xpra-20190109-1.el6_8.x86_64 : x264 library for xpra Repo : xpra-el6-x86_64 Matched from: Filename : /usr/lib64/xpra/libx264.so.155
